Transaction 4ecbb280f1468bcf0ed9336307049a55633b2d6e356f363614113204d642bb41
1 Input
1 Output
-
4ecbb280f1468bcf0ed9336307049a55633b2d6e356f363614113204d642bb41:0
- value
- 104296
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e5e3a3dce413b98dd9cfc53e632337ef179efc4
- address
- bc1q8e0r50wwgyae3hvul3f7vv3n0mchnm7yfl2pvz